Output 629016cd4ac857dbb0c3ab09cacf2b581cb0f7af7cdec1f4937e4a73c28e0ce2:2

value
15027415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d8dd08938b5c8dba416ee8addb682378e330737 OP_EQUAL
address
MLodPvqQathy4RKGqp9uX8V5qb1G7jTLD1
transaction
629016cd4ac857dbb0c3ab09cacf2b581cb0f7af7cdec1f4937e4a73c28e0ce2
spent
true